The 'Harry Potter Trace' in fanfiction can be a plot - driving device. It restricts the actions of young characters, making their magical experiences more complex. Fanfiction authors use it to create tension. Say, a young wizard in a fanfic wants to protect his family from dark forces but using magic would alert the Ministry via the Trace. This conflict between doing what's right and following the wizarding law makes for an interesting story.
